Peru Moda 2015 seeks for Peruvian Brands Internationalization

The internationalization of Peruvian brands by displaying its products at US department stores is one of the goals of “Peru Moda 2015” international fashion event, Foreign Trade and Tourism Minister Magali Silva affirmed.

In order to make this possible, one Peruvian brand and a designer introducing the best proposals on the catwalk will be granted a point of sale at famous Macy's department store.

Road to Macy's

"Representatives of Macy's and the Greater Washington Fashion Chamber of Commerce will have the difficult task to pick one of these duos. Each will be granted a point of sale at one of its stores; the brand and the creative designer,” Silva told.

According to the Minister, the initiative implemented by the Greater Washington Fashion Chamber of Commerce, thanks to an alliance established with Macy's, aims at contributing to the fashion industry through the development of networks, implementation of educational programs, work training and assistance to professionals, entrepreneurs and sector’s designers. 

In this sense, both organizations inked an agreement with Peru’s Export and Tourism Promotion Board (Promperu) to enable Peruvian brands to become internationalized.

According to Minister Silva, the Washington D.C.-based Peru Commercial office (OCEX) also undertook efforts towards reaching this goal.
